摘 要: | 城市地域系统的结构决定了城市低碳发展的基础。在反思传统城市地域系统规划低碳发展的局限性基础上,以临港新城低碳城市地域系统优化案例为研究对象,对空间结构、土地利用、交通体系等城市地域系统核心构成要素进行低碳优化分析。研究指出低碳城市地域系统在空间结构上具有高密度、高容积率、高层的紧凑型特征,多中心的梯级空间格局,分散组团式的空间开发;集约化、多样化的复合功能的土地开发;公共交通导向的走廊式空间规划,发达的小地域空间道路体系等特点。

Abstract: | The structure of the urban regional system determines the development foundation of low-carbon city. Based on reviewing the limitations of traditional urban regional system planning for low-carbon development, it optimizes the spatial structure, land use, transportation systems and other core elements of urban regional constitutes to a low-carbon city with a case study of Lingang low-carbon city regional system optimization. The research indicates that the low-carbon urban regional system has certainly some characteristics, which are the compact spatial structure with high density, high volume rate, and high-rise, multi-center echelon spatial pattern, spatial development in dispersion cluster; intensification, diversification, and complex functions of the land development ; public transport corridor oriented spatial planning, developed road system within small geographical space. |
